It's common for the head gasket to fail near the #1 exhaust port with oil dripping on the chain tensioner and alternator, not to mention leaking into #1 and sometimes #2 cylinders. A coolant breach of the head gasket is a separate issue that seems to occur around the #4 cylinder. Oil pooling by the Garrett wastegate arm is more likely from the turbo oil supply junction atop the center section of the turbo. I don't think you can see a KKK wastegate arm so I'll assume you have a Garrett.

The trick is to determine whether the water pump failed on its own or the seal blew as a result of excessive coolant system pressure. The water pump should hold better than the system's 1.4 bar rating, though.
